It is very fitting that on the eve of the Towers Hotel Killarney Historic Rally that Craig Breen’s family have announced details of the Craig Breen Foundation.
The foundation will support drivers in the Junior 1000 category competing in Irish rallies.
The prize fund will run to over €35,000.
With support from Hyundai Motorsport and Sports 4 You, the team Craig drive for this year on the Portuguese championship, the winner will get the opportunity to drive a Hyundai on a Spanish/Portuguese Hyundai i20 Cup round.

The top two drivers will enjoy a day’s tuition at John Haughland’s Rally School in Norway .
Breen’s co-driver Paul Nagle will offer a day of pacenote training for the top-three championship finishers.
The foundation was announced on the day before the Killarney Historic Rally.
Craig loved this event and came here to play every year since 2018 . The first time here he drove a MG Metro 6R4 as a course car. The following year, driving a Ford Escort Mk2, he finished second.
Pandemic aside, he was back again in 2021, this time as winner in a BMW M3 E30.

Last year, he was involved in an epic duel with eventual winner Jonny Greer, driving his ex Frank Meagher Ford Sierra Cosworth.
